Expert Review: Vinilia Wine Resort
Vinilia Wine Resort, Manduria: A "Magical" Michelin Key Selected Retreat in Salento
Vinilia Wine Resort in Manduria, Italy, a Michelin Key Selected property, consistently receives high praise from guests, often described as a "magical place" that offers a luxurious and relaxing escape. Housed in a beautifully restored early 20th-century castle, the resort blends historic charm with modern design and exceptional hospitality.

3. Room Quality
The rooms at Vinilia Wine Resort are described as comfortable, unique, and elegantly designed. Each of the 18 rooms offers an exclusive atmosphere, with beds made of tufa stone alternating with iron and wood pieces by local craftsmen. They are equipped with air-conditioning, private bathrooms, a mini-bar, work desk, and free WiFi. Comfort is a key aspect, with "comfortable bed[s]" and premium bedding including down comforters. Rooms feature beautiful designer elements and large windows overlooking the surrounding countryside. Deluxe Double Rooms are approximately 344 sq ft, while Superior Double Rooms are around 291 sq ft.
4. Dining Experience
The dining experience at Vinilia Wine Resort centers around the Casamatta Restaurant, which holds a Michelin star. The modern and romantic restaurant serves Italian cuisine, with vegetarian, vegan, and gluten-free options available. Chef Pietro Penna utilizes locally sourced produce, much of it from the restaurant's own kitchen garden, to create modern and imaginative dishes, including three tasting menus. While many guests have found the restaurant "splendid", some have expressed that the Michelin-starred cuisine "did not have the wow factor" or even described it as having "perverse tastes and bitter food." The wine list is extensive, with a particular focus on Primitivo di Manduria, as the resort aims to be "the home of Primitivo di Manduria."
Breakfast receives high praise, with a guest review score of 7.5. It's described as "very good" and "astonishing," featuring fresh local cheese and charcuterie. Options include Continental, Italian, Vegetarian, Vegan, Gluten-free, and a buffet, with the possibility of in-room service.

6. Location & Accessibility
Vinilia Wine Resort is situated in Manduria, "in the heart of the Salento area," surrounded by olive groves and vineyards. While it offers a tranquil countryside setting, some guests note its "isolated" nature, requiring a drive or taxi to reach Manduria town. The resort is conveniently located about 31 miles (50 km) from Brindisi Airport, a scenic 45-minute drive. It also provides easy access to the Manduria Train Station, which is a short walk away. Nearby attractions include Taranto Sotterranea (21 miles / 34 km) and Castello Aragonese (22 miles / 36 km), as well as Lecce and Ostuni. Free on-site parking is available.
